compromise action

An elaborate ritual in which both parties shave off slices of their pride, leaving behind a bland agreement byzantinely titled "compromise". It feigns acceptance of the other's demands while burying one's true desires in the shadows. Rumored to originate in boardrooms and living rooms alike, it rebrands half-measures as mutual "growth" demanding applause. It grants a fleeting peace at the cost of an eternal whisper of regret in the heart. Truly, the art of giving up just enough to call it winning.

praxis

Praxis is the sacred rite that drags grand theories from the dusty pages of abstraction into the harsh arena of reality, where they suffer through trials of pain and humiliation. Many boast lofty ideals, but praxis stands as the relentless prosecutor, exposing contradictions behind every lofty declaration. Anyone can preach theory from the safety of words, yet only praxis jeers at truth and strips away the ornamentation of beliefs. The more one demands consistency between thought and action, the deeper one is forced to confront self-deception. Thus praxis is both a sublime epiphany and the most base form of self-incrimination.

swipe

A swipe is the modern ritual of deciding another’s fate with a flick of the finger, reducing romance to instantaneous judgment. This gesture, balancing capricious attraction and silent rejection, wounds more swiftly than any heartfelt conversation. It judges the person behind the screen in a heartbeat and buries them in a graveyard of forgetfulness by dawn. The act of sealing off potential connections with one digit is itself an irony of celebrating freedom of choice. Swiping transforms empathy into a momentary thrill and an expiration date.
